Problem

2 /6


0-1 حقيبة ظهر: الحد الأدنى من العناصر

Problem

معطى N عناصر الكتلة m 1 ، & hellip ؛، m N . إنهم يملأون حقيبة ظهر لا تتحمل وزنًا لا يزيد عن M . كيف تكتسب الوزن بدقة في M باستخدام أقل عدد ممكن من العناصر؟
& nbsp؛
الإدخال:
- يحتوي السطر الأول على رقم طبيعي N لا يتجاوز 100 ورقم طبيعي M لا يتجاوز 10000 ؛
- السطر الثاني يحتوي على N أرقام طبيعية m i لا تتجاوز 100.
& nbsp؛
الإخراج: & nbsp؛ اطبع أصغر عدد من العناصر التي تحتاجها ، أو 0 إذا لم تتمكن من الوصول إلى الوزن المحدد. نبسب ؛

نبسب ؛

أمثلة <الجسم>
# إدخال الإخراج
1
1 5968
18
0